 *  RTooltip.m
 *
 *  Created by Hans-J. Bibiko on 26/02/2012.
 *
 *  Usage:
 *  #import "Tools/RTooltip.h"
 *  
 *  [RTooltip showWithObject:@"Hello World"];
 *
 *  [RTooltip showWithObject:@"<h1>Hello</h1>I am a <b>tooltip</b>" ofType:@"html" 
 *          displayOptions:[NSDictionary dictionaryWithObjectsAndKeys:
 *          @"Monaco", @"fontname", 
 *          @"#EEEEEE", @"backgroundcolor", 
 *          @"20", @"fontsize", 
 *          @"transparent", @"transparent", nil]];
 *  
 *  [RTooltip  showWithObject:(id)content 
 *                  atLocation:(NSPoint)point 
 *                      ofType:(NSString *)type 
 *              displayOptions:(NSDictionary *)displayOptions]
 *  
 *          content: a NSString with the actual content; a NSImage object AND type:"image"
 *            point: n NSPoint where the tooltip should be shown
 *                   if not given it will be shown under the current caret position or
 *                   if no caret could be found in the upper left corner of the current window
 *                     a passed NSPoint of {-1, -1} will use the current adjusted mouse position
 *             type: a NSString of: "text", "html", or "image"; no type - 'text' is default
 *   displayOptions: a NSDictionary with the following keys (all values must be of type NSString):
 *                         fontname, fontsize, backgroundcolor (as #RRGGBB), transparent (any value)
 *                   if no displayOptions are passed or if a key doesn't exist the following default
 *                   are taken:
 *                         "Lucida Grande", "10", "#F9FBC5", NO
 *  
 *  See more possible syntaxa in RTooltip to init a tooltip
 */
